Create and Send your Christmas Ornament to Old St. Pat’s!

We are not “US” without all of YOU!  

Most years, Old St. Pat’s is honored to host over 5,000 members, friends, and neighbors on our campus to celebrate Christmas Eve and Christmas Day liturgies.  In order to keep one another safe this year, most of us will be celebrating Christmas Mass in our “domestic churches” rather than the beautifully decorated church, our beloved Hughes Hall, or our 625 W. Adams space.

Leading up to our Christmas Eve and Christmas Day Livestream liturgies, we would like to invite any and all members and friends to create or purchase a Christmas ornament that speaks to what faith and church community means to you. We then welcome you to drop off or send those ornaments to Old St. Pat’s so that we might place them on the Christmas Trees in the sanctuary and have a part of you right there when we sing out our Christmas Alleluias together.  You can send ornaments to us using the address below or drop them off at our 711 W Monroe building between 8 am and 3 pm Monday - Friday.

Sharing Your Advent and Christmas Season Moments

Theologian and friend of Old St. Pat’s, Jack Shea, reminds us that especially this year, “intentionality is key” when it comes to preparing ourselves to celebrate Christmas. Whether it is decorating a Christmas tree, lighting Advent candles, setting up a simple creche scene in your home, or making Christmas cookies - if we do these things with intentionality, our spirits can find peace and even healing.
